Frequently Asked Questions

What type of boiler is used in an AAC block plant?

AAC block plants use industrial steam boilers — typically fire-tube (smoke-tube) or water-tube designs — to generate saturated steam at 12–14 bar pressure for autoclave curing. Common fuel types include coal, rice husk, biomass briquettes, and natural gas. Boiler capacity is sized to the autoclave load: a 300 CBM/day plant typically requires 6–8 tonnes of steam per hour. Maruti Hydraulics supplies IBR-approved boilers in partnership with Thermax, with complete skid-mounted packages including FD fans, economisers, and steam headers.

How is boiler capacity calculated for an AAC plant?

Boiler capacity for an AAC plant is determined by the autoclave cycle requirements. Each autoclave batch requires steam to heat blocks from ambient temperature to 190°C, maintain pressure for 8–10 hours, then depressurise. A standard rule of thumb is 1 tonne of steam per hour per 25–30 CBM of daily plant capacity. For a 300 CBM/day plant with two autoclaves, a 10–12 tonne per hour boiler is typically specified. Maruti Hydraulics engineers calculate the exact steam balance based on your autoclave dimensions, cycle schedule, and insulation specification.

Can biomass or waste fuel be used in AAC plant boilers?

Yes. Biomass-fired boilers are increasingly popular for AAC plants across India due to lower fuel cost and alignment with green manufacturing goals. Suitable fuels include rice husk, groundnut shells, sugarcane bagasse, wood chips, and biomass briquettes. Maruti Hydraulics supplies biomass-fired boilers with stoker grates or spreader-stoker systems, multi-cyclone dust collectors, and bag filters to meet pollution norms. Gas-fired boilers are also available for plants near natural gas pipelines.
